Decision summary

A Fitness to Practise Panel has found a conviction for attempting to supply cannabis and failing to promptly inform her employer of her arrest and ongoing police investigation proved against Jane Alana Williams, a registered residential child care worker.

The Panel found Ms Williams current fitness to practise was impaired and imposed a Removal Order which means she can no longer work in any regulated social care role in Wales. Jane Alan Williams name will be taken off the register and placed on the List of Persons Removed

Jane Alana Williams has the right of appeal to the Care Standards Tribunal within 28 days.

Summary of allegations

Ms Williams was convicted of attempting to supply a quantity of 32.86 grams of Cannabis, and failed to promptly inform her employer of her arrest and ongoing police investigation.
